.content
{background:#1e1e1e;
height:600px;
width:920px;}

.googleMap, .contactDetails
{height:530px;
width:375px;
background:#2f2e2e;
margin-top:36px;}

.googleMap
{float:right;
margin-right:46px;}

.contactDetails
{float:left;
margin-left:46px;}

.contactDetails p
{padding:0 20px 0 40px;}

.contactDetails img
{padding:20px 20px 10px 20px;}

fieldset {
border:none;
padding:0;
margin:30px 0 40px 0;
}
form
{font-family:Arial, Helvetica, sans-serif;
font-size:12px;
color:#bcbcbc;
width:375px;}

input, textarea
{float:left;
width:230px;
margin-left:10px;
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
color:#1e1e1e;
text-align:left;}

label
{float:left;
width:50px;
clear:both;
text-align:left;
margin-left:40px;}

button
{background:url(../img/submitButton.jpg) no-repeat 0 0;
clear:both;
height:20px;
float:right;
width:80px;
cursor:pointer;
margin-top:10px;
margin-right:40px;
border:none;}

input:focus, textarea:focus
{background-color:#dcdbdb;}

.required {
color:#FF0000;
float:right;
text-align:right;
width:300px;
font-weight:bold;
padding:5px 40px 5px 5px;
}

p.contactInfo
{margin-top:60px;}
p.contAddress
{font-size:16px;}

.contactImages img
{padding:0;
margin:0 0 0 37px;
border:none;}

.radioButtons
{clear:both;
margin-top:10px;
margin-bottom:0;}

.radioButtons label
{float:left;
width:100px;}
.radioButtons input
{width:10px;
margin:0;
padding:0;}
.radioButtons input.email
{float:left;
margin:0 0 0 30px;}
.radioButtons input.phone
{float:left;
margin:0 0 0 30px;}
label.emailLabel, label.phoneLabel
{float:none;
margin:0 0 0 10px;}
